Compliance with Charter Provisions and Laws and Regulations Sample Clauses

Compliance with Charter Provisions and Laws and Regulations. (a) Company and Company Sub are not (and since July 31, 2002 have not been) in default under or in breach or violation of (i) any provision of their respective Certificates of Incorporation, as amended, or Bylaws, as amended, or (ii) any order, writ, injunction, law, ordinance, rule or regulation promulgated by any Governmental Entity except, with respect to this clause (ii), for such violations as would not have, individually or in the aggregate, a Material Adverse Effect. No investigation by any Governmental Entity with respect to Company, Company Sub or any other Subsidiary of Company is pending or, to the knowledge of Company and Company Sub, threatened, other than, in each case, those which, individually or in the aggregate, would not have a Material Adverse Effect.

Compliance with Charter Provisions and Laws and Regulations. (a) Neither Company nor any of the Company Subsidiaries is in default under or in breach or violation of (i) any provision its Certificate of Incorporation or Articles of Association, as amended, or Bylaws, as amended, or (ii) any law, ordinance, rule or regulation promulgated by any Governmental Entity, except, with respect to this clause (ii), for such violations as would not have, individually or in the aggregate, a Material Adverse Effect. Except for routine examinations by Federal or state Governmental Entities charged with the supervision or regulation of banks or bank holding companies or engaged in the insurance of bank deposits, to the best knowledge of Company, no investigation by any Governmental Entity with respect to Company or any of the Company Subsidiaries is pending or threatened, other than, in each case, those the outcome of which, individually or in the aggregate, would not have a Material Adverse Effect.

Compliance with Charter Provisions and Laws and Regulations. (a) Neither Company nor any of the Company Subsidiaries is in default under or in breach or violation of (i) any provision of its Articles or Certificate of Incorporation, as amended, or Bylaws, as amended, or (ii) any Law, except, with respect to this clause (ii), for such violations as would not have, or would not reasonably be expected to have, individually or in the aggregate, a Material Adverse Effect. Except for routine examinations by Federal or state Governmental Entities charged with the supervision or regulation of federal savings banks or savings and loan holding companies or engaged in the insurance of bank deposits, to the best knowledge of Company, no investigation or inquiry by any Governmental Entity with respect to Company or any of the Company Subsidiaries is pending or threatened. There are no material unresolved violations, criticisms or exceptions by any Governmental Entity with respect to any report or statement relating to any examination of Company or any of its Subsidiaries.

  • Compliance with Agreements and Laws The Seller has all requisite licenses, permits and certificates, including environmental, health and safety permits, from federal, state and local authorities necessary to conduct its business and own and operate its assets (collectively, the "Permits"). Schedule 2.17 attached hereto sets forth a true, correct and complete list of all such Permits, copies of which have previously been delivered by the Seller to the Buyer. The Seller is not in violation of any law, regulation or ordinance (including, without limitation, laws, regulations or ordinances relating to building, zoning, environmental, disposal of hazardous substances, land use or similar matters) relating to its properties, the violation of which could have a material adverse effect on the Seller or its properties. The business of the Seller does not violate, in any material respect, any federal, state, local or foreign laws, regulations or orders (including, but not limited to, any of the foregoing relating to employment discrimination, occupational safety, environmental protection, hazardous waste (as defined in the Resource Conservation and Recovery Act, as amended, and the regulations adopted pursuant thereto), conservation, or corrupt practices, the enforcement of which would have a material and adverse effect on the results of operations, condition (financial or otherwise), assets, properties, business or prospects of the Seller. Except as set forth on Schedule 2.17 attached hereto, the Seller has not since January 1, 1993 received any notice or communication from any federal, state or local governmental or regulatory authority or otherwise of any such violation or noncompliance.

  • Compliance with Laws, Rules and Regulations Tenant, at its sole cost and expense, shall comply with all laws, ordinances, orders, rules and regulations of state, federal, municipal, or other agencies or bodies having jurisdiction over use, condition, and occupancy of the Leased Premises. Tenant must use and maintain the Leased Premises in a clean, careful, safe, and proper manner and in compliance with all Applicable Laws, including Applicable Laws pertaining to health, safety, disabled persons, and the environment; provided, however, that Tenant shall not be required to make any structural changes or repairs to the Leased Premises unless the need for such structural changes or repairs is caused by Tenant, its agents, employees, invitees, or others for whom Tenant is responsible pursuant to the terms and provisions of this Lease. Notwithstanding anything to the contrary contained elsewhere in this section, it is expressly agreed and understood that Tenant’s obligation to comply with all Applicable Laws does not apply to any violations of Applicable Laws that (a) were in effect and (b) were being violated or with which the Leased Premises was not in compliance immediately prior to the time Tenant accepted the Leased Premises, including without limitation any existing environmental contamination. Tenant will comply with the rules and regulations of the Leased Premises adopted by Landlord in its reasonable discretion. All such rules and regulations and changes and amendments thereto will be sent by Landlord to Tenant in writing and shall thereafter be carried out and observed by Tenant.

  • Compliance with Applicable Laws, Rules and Regulations The Dealer Manager represents to the Company that (a) it is a member of FINRA in good standing, and (b) it and its employees and representatives who will perform services hereunder have all required licenses and registrations to act under this Agreement. With respect to its participation and the participation by each Participating Dealer in the offer and sale of the Offered Shares (including, without limitation, any resales and transfers of Offered Shares), the Dealer Manager agrees, and, by virtue of entering into the Participating Dealer Agreement, each Participating Dealer shall have agreed, to comply with any applicable requirements of the Securities Act and the Exchange Act, applicable state securities or blue sky laws, and, specifically including, but not in any way limited to, NASD Conduct Rules 2340 and 2420, and FINRA Conduct Rules 2310, 5130 and 5141.

  • Compliance with Applicable Laws, Governing Documents and Trust Compliance Procedures In the performance of its duties and obligations under this Agreement, the Sub-Advisor shall, with respect to Sub-Advisor Assets, (i) act in conformity with: (A) the Trust’s Agreement and Declaration of Trust (the “Declaration of Trust”) and By-Laws; (B) the Prospectus; (C) the policies and procedures for compliance by the Trust with the Federal Securities Laws (as that term is defined in Rule 38a-1 under the 0000 Xxx) provided to the Sub-Advisor (together, the “Trust Compliance Procedures”); and (D) the instructions and directions received in writing from the Advisor or the Trustees of the Trust; and (ii) conform to and comply with the requirements of the 1940 Act, the Advisers Act, and all other federal laws applicable to registered investment companies’ and Sub-Advisors’ duties under this Agreement. The Advisor will provide the Sub-Advisor with any materials or information that the Sub-Advisor may reasonably request to enable it to perform its duties and obligations under this Agreement. The Advisor will provide the Sub-Advisor with reasonable advance notice, in writing, of: (i) any change in a Fund’s investment objectives, policies and restrictions as stated in the Prospectus; (ii) any change to the Trust’s Declaration of Trust or By-Laws; or (iii) any material change in the Trust Compliance Procedures; and the Sub-Advisor, in the performance of its duties and obligations under this Agreement, shall manage the Sub-Advisor Assets consistently with such changes, provided the Sub-Advisor has received such prior notice of the effectiveness of such changes from the Trust or the Advisor. In addition to such notice, the Advisor shall provide to the Sub-Advisor a copy of a modified Prospectus and copies of the revised Trust Compliance Procedures, as applicable, reflecting such changes. The Sub-Advisor hereby agrees to provide to the Advisor in a timely manner, in writing, such information relating to the Sub-Advisor and its relationship to, and actions for, a Fund as may be required to be contained in the Prospectus or in the Trust’s registration statement on Form N-1A, or otherwise as reasonably requested by the Advisor. In order to assist the Trust and the Trust’s Chief Compliance Officer (the “Trust CCO”) to satisfy the requirements contained in Rule 38a-1 under the 1940 Act, the Sub-Advisor shall provide to the Trust CCO: (i) direct access to the Sub-Advisor’s chief compliance officer (the “Sub-Advisor CCO”), as reasonably requested by the Trust CCO; (ii) quarterly reports confirming that the Sub-Advisor has complied with the Trust Compliance Procedures in managing the Sub-Advisor Assets; and (iii) quarterly certifications that there were no Material Compliance Matters (as that term is defined by Rule 38a-1(e)(2)) that arose under the Trust Compliance Procedures that related to the Sub-Advisor’s management of the Sub-Advisor Assets.
